在当今的开发者社区中,GitHub是一个不可或缺的平台,每周都有大量的项目被创建和更新。这些项目的热度反映了开发者们对新技术的关注与需求。本文将深入分析GitHub本周热门项目的特点和趋势,帮助开发者了解当前的技术走向与实践。
GitHub热门项目概述
什么是GitHub热门项目?
GitHub热门项目通常是指在特定时间段内,获得最多星标(Star)的项目。这些项目往往代表了当前开发者的兴趣、需求以及流行技术的变化。每周,GitHub都会根据各个项目的受欢迎程度,生成一份热度排行榜。
为什么关注GitHub热门项目?
- 获取灵感:热门项目常常展示了创新的想法和解决方案。
- 学习新技术:通过研究热门项目,可以学习到最新的编程技巧与工具。
- 参与开源:许多热门项目都是开源的,参与其中能够提升自己的编程技能及合作能力。
本周热门项目推荐
1. 项目A:高效的Web框架
- 描述:项目A是一个新的Web框架,旨在提高开发效率和应用性能。
- 亮点:
- 轻量级结构
- 高效的路由处理
- 丰富的插件生态
2. 项目B:机器学习工具包
- 描述:项目B是一个功能强大的机器学习工具包,提供了多种算法实现。
- 亮点:
- 支持多种数据格式
- 易于集成到现有项目
- 丰富的文档与示例
3. 项目C:前端UI组件库
- 描述:项目C是一个前端UI组件库,专注于响应式设计与可用性。
- 亮点:
- 多种预设主题
- 可自定义组件
- 活跃的社区支持
如何找到GitHub热门项目
使用GitHub搜索功能
在GitHub的搜索框中输入关键字,如“热门项目”,然后使用过滤器筛选出本周的项目。
关注开发者与组织
关注一些活跃的开发者和组织,能够及时获取他们发布的热门项目。
加入社区讨论
参与相关的技术论坛、Slack频道或Discord服务器,通常会有关于热门项目的推荐。
GitHub热门项目的评价标准
在评估一个热门项目时,可以考虑以下标准:
- 星标数量:越多的星标通常意味着项目越受欢迎。
- Fork数量:Fork数量多的项目说明开发者对其有较高的使用兴趣。
- 活跃度:查看项目的提交频率和社区活跃度。
GitHub本周热门项目的影响力
对开发者的影响
- 技术学习:开发者通过参与热门项目,可以获得实践经验。
- 职业发展:参与热门项目能增强个人简历,提高就业竞争力。
对行业的影响
- 推动创新:热门项目常常带动行业内的技术变革。
- 社区合作:激发开发者之间的合作与知识共享。
FAQ(常见问题解答)
GitHub的热门项目是如何计算的?
GitHub通过算法计算每个项目在过去一周内获得的星标和Fork数量,从而生成热门项目排行榜。
如何参与GitHub的热门项目?
您可以通过Fork项目、提交代码、报告问题或参与讨论等方式参与热门项目。
为什么某些项目突然变得热门?
项目的热门通常与新技术的推出、行业趋势的变化或开发者的兴趣点相关。例如,某项新技术的发布可能会吸引大量关注。
如何评价一个GitHub项目的质量?
可以通过查看项目的文档、代码质量、活跃度和社区反馈等方面来评估项目的质量。
GitHub热门项目的更新频率如何?
热门项目的更新频率通常比较高,活跃的开发者会定期对项目进行维护和升级,以确保其与时俱进。
总之,GitHub本周热门项目不仅反映了开发者的关注点,更是技术趋势的风向标。通过关注和参与这些项目,开发者能够获取前沿的技术资源和知识,为自己的职业发展助力。希望本文能为你提供有效的参考与帮助!
正文完